Output f61f6aa2fc944db661c887797d8abc2261189fc20256fc4e7e93248c5a76f14c:4

value
940962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f42c93d67e43808f7eb54d7f3d958a2dea435931 OP_EQUAL
address
3Px6CeaoWBUXF8bPBExNyiYaJQcEQcvAkq
transaction
f61f6aa2fc944db661c887797d8abc2261189fc20256fc4e7e93248c5a76f14c
confirmations
369443
spent
true